Rock band L'Arc~en~Ciel is still in the middle of an international tour that started in April and ends next month, but reports have emerged that they won't be performing again until 2011.
The speculation was born from a newspaper ad that mentioned the group's new single this summer and a concert titled "2011 NEXT LIVE 20th L'Anniversary Live." Since the show is scheduled for the band's big anniversary three years from now, the word "next" appears to suggest that fans may not hear from them for a long time. However, even if their next concert isn't until 2011, it doesn't necessarily mean that they won't be active as a band.
Some believe that the members of L'Arc plan to use the three years to work on their own solo projects, but nothing official has been stated by the band or their management so far.
